Kingshighway Viaduct, Revisited

Update: The old viaduct has been replaced with a new bridge which opened in 2017.

The days are numbered for the old Kingshighway Viaduct, about to be reduced to rubble in the next month or so. I stopped by to take some pictures of the demolition, only to realize it had not yet begun. Turns out some people are grumbling about this mismatch in closure and demolition. I would assume that the moving of utilities is underway before demolition.
